From 3388bd9e9b82df6d7fe79fa4eee7c22a3277624e Mon Sep 17 00:00:00 2001 From: Dimitri Staessens Date: Tue, 21 Jul 2026 06:54:55 +0200 Subject: ipcpd: Add flow overshoot protection to mb-ecn The ECN marks were the only source of congestion information, and going into congestion collapse (dropping a lot of ECN packets and causing loss of signal) was unrecoverable. The sender's slow-start ramp clock now tracks a measured RTT to avoid overshooting into congestion collapse on the previously fixed (14ms) doubling on long-delay (e.g. 100ms) links. The flow allocator now carries a periodic heartbeat/ack to keep RTT estimates up-to-date. The heartbeat also serves as a congestion collapse detector: consecutive heartbeat losses will go into loss recovery, halving the window and pausing Additive Increase until the path is clear. The DT component now has a max_rtt config parameter that serves as a hint for the layer RTT to optimize slow-start for low-latency networks. These two mechanisms follow TCP, however only during slow start up to the first ECN signal and to recover from a total collapse until the ECN signal returns. MB-ECN is still fully RTT-independent in the AI/PD region. A shorter RTT path will just reach its equal fair share faster than a longer RTT path.
